About the Role: This position will ensure implementation and coordination of financial and administrative processes surrounding fixed asset and inventory management for the North American business which has several industrial facilities.
Main Responsibilities: * Ensure integrity and validity of inventory and fixed asset information * Lead external and Internal Audit support and execution on Fixed Asset and Inventory areas * Review of leasing engagements to ensure proper IFRS16 impact.
Maintain IFRS16 tool and ensure proper postings.
* Making recommendations and implement necessary changes with policies and procedures to support accounting methodologies and compliance objectives * Safeguard assets and ensure proper inventory counts are in place and tag controls are maintained.
* Organize and ensure all cycle counts and yearend counts have been performed as per the inventory count procedure from the group.
* Reconciliation of information between systems related to SAP and Hyperion data management Who we are looking for: * Bachelor's degree in Finance or related field preferred.
* At least 4 years of relevant experience; industrial background preferred * Knowledge of U.S.
GAAP and IFRS * Knowledge of ERP and reporting systems; SAP preferred * Present information related to inventory and asset area to executive management via power point presentations.
* Ability to influence others by having the necessary interpersonal skills to enforce policies and drive process * Strong experience with improvement initiatives and enhancements * Must be a detail oriented, problem solver who can work in a fast-paced environment * Approximately 10-20% of travel within the U.S.
to support the one manufacturing facility and over 50 store locations.
Compensation Data The base salary range for this position is $74,693.00- $99,590.00 annually.
